Vodacom M-Pesa, PayPal Partner To Expand Access To Global Digital Payments For Tanzanians

Summary by TechFinancials
Vodacom M-Pesa Tanzania has announced a new partnership with PayPal that will enable customers in Tanzania to seamlessly transfer funds between their PayPal and M-Pesa wallets through the M-Pesa Super App;. As part of M-Pesa’s broader Global payments solutions, this marks a significant step forward in expanding access to global digital financial services.
